I wouldn't worry about the 24 pin plug, if you've got a 20pin ATX socket, just hang the extra 4 pins over the edge. What's the problem? Also, you should be perfectly fine using an English kettle lead with the PSU. The only difference is that English wall plugs have the earth connection as a 3rd pin, whereas the European ones have a hole where the wall sockets have a pin.

lian li themselves actually advertised it as 'easily removable', but in fact it is riveted in place (i guess you have to decide yourself how 'removable it is :p).

i was going to remove mine but decided it doesn't ACTUALLY restrict airflow that much (as i'm just not going to put a HDD there) but more directs it straight to the motherboard :D
 
I think the very early ones were removable. There were a few pics early in the [H] thread that showed this feature.
